Academic Year Regulations for 2024/2025 Graduation Sessions
-
End of Academic Year 2024-2025: March 2, 2026.
-
You may submit a declaration of intent to graduate by March 2, 2026, on www.studenti.unipi.it (using the "attesa laurea" application) without renewing your enrollment for the 2025/2026 academic year or paying the first installment. The system will issue a receipt.
-
If you do not graduate by March 2, 2026, the graduation waiting application allows you to regularize your enrollment for the 2025/26 academic year by March 31, 2026, without paying late fees.

Eni and Eni Corporate University offer to students enrolled in the Msc in Exploration and Applied Geophysics up to 3 stages
Duration and Aim of the stages - The stages are 3-month long and are aimed at preparing the MSc thesis.
The thesis tutors (an internal tutor from Unipi and an external tutor from Eni) define the thesis topic.
Who can apply? - Students who satisfy the following requirements can be selected:
- To be regularly enrolled at the second year of the MSc in Exploration and Applied Geophysics of the University of Pisa.
- Not to be over 26 years old on the date of December 31, 2022
- To have a weighted average of marks equal or higher than 27/30
- To have passed at least three of the following exams: Applied Geophysics; Exploration Seismology and Introduction to Well-Logs; Laboratory of Geophysical Data Processing; Laboratory of Seismic Acquisition and Processing; Signal Processing for Physics.
The application must include:
- Curriculum vitae;
- Certificate (art. 46 and 47 of D.p.r. 28.12.2000 n. 445) reporting the list of passed exams (with marks and ECTS) provided by the University
- Certificate (art. 46 and 47 of D.p.r. 28.12.2000 n. 445) of enrollment to the second year of the MSc provided by the University
- Self-certification of degree of knowledge of written and oral English and any supporting documentation
Deadline for application - This documentation must be sent strictly within January 26, 2023 to the following email account: application@eni.com and, in cc, to gea@dst.unipi.it
In the email subject must be reported the wording “Candidatura stage – Progetto Geologia 2023”.
After a positive evaluation of requisites, candidates will be examined via oral and practical tests (distance mode) that will take place from the 30th of January to the 1st of February 2023.
Job Opportunities for MSc in Exploration and Applied Geophysics Graduates
Our graduates are equipped with advanced knowledge and practical skills in geophysics, making them highly requested by the job market. Since the fundation of our MSc degree our former students have consistently secured rewarding positions in various industries and in academia worlwide. Currently more than 90% of our graduates is stably employed both in the industry or academia (see figure at the bottom of the page). Our comprehensive MSc program prepares you for a diverse range of exciting career paths including:
1. Georesources exploration:
As geophysicists specialized in energy exploration, our graduates will play a crucial role in the identification and assessment of subsurface georesources (including mineral exploration) providing support to conventional and renewable energy projects. exploration geophysicists will be responsible for the acquisition, processing and interpretation of geophysical data, conducting geophysical surveys, and contributing to the overall understanding of subsurface structures. This role is essential for optimizing the exploration and production processes within the energy sector and for the responsible and sustainable extraction of georesources. About 40% of graduates currently works in different energy and mining industries and geophysical service companies around the world.
2. Environmental monitoring:
As Environmental Geophysicists, our graduates will apply a wide range of geophysical techniques to assess and monitor environmental conditions of the soil and groundwater. They will play a key role in understanding subsurface characteristics, identifying potential environmental risks, and contributing to remediation efforts. This role is crucial for ensuring the sustainable management of natural resources and mitigating the impact of human activities on the environment. about 20% of our graduates work in environmental consulting companies or geovernmental agencies.
3. Geophysical engineering:
As applied geophysicists, our graduates will use geophysical techniques to solve engineering challenges across various sectors. Your role will involve using advanced geophysical methods to investigate subsurface conditions (e.g. to evaluate soil stability and foundation conditions), assess structural integrity, and support the design and construction of infrastructure projects. Their work will also focus on the monitoring of landslides and soil subsidence. This position is essential for ensuring the safety, efficiency, and sustainability of civil engineering projects. About 15% of our graduates work in the engineering sector.
5. Research and Development:
About 25% of our graduates continue the career path pursuing a PhD in Geophysics contributing to the development of new geophysical technologies and methodologies. As researchers, our graduates will be at the forefront of research in geophysics to better understand the physics of earthquakes and volcanic processes. Their work will involve analyzing geophysical data, developing new methods for data analysis, conducting research, and collaborating with multidisciplinary teams to advance our understanding of Earth's dynamic processes (such as earthquakes and volcanic eruptions). Many former students of our master currently work in important academic institutions, research centres and governative organizations performing seismic and volcanic surveillance.
